Across TCGA pan-cancer cohorts, RAB40C Mutation is linked to patient survival in 5 of 34 cancer types, making it a survival-associated RAB40C data layer compared with 17 for mass-spec protein and 6 for mass-spec protein.

The strongest signal is observed in cervical squamous cell carcinoma and endocervical adenocarcinoma (CESC), where higher RAB40C Mutation is associated with worse disease-free survival. In most high-consensus cancer types, elevated RAB40C expression acts as an unfavorable survival marker.

CESC, PRAD, and UCEC are the cancer types where RAB40C Mutation most reproducibly stratifies survival.
